This tender involves the refurbishment and delivery of various turbine auxiliary oil pumps, including seal oil, vacuum, stator coolant, and ammonia dosing pumps at Grootvlei Power Station over a five-year period. Interested bidders must demonstrate expertise in pump refurbishment and compliance with safety and environmental standards.
The Grootvlei Power Station seeks qualified contractors for the refurbishment and delivery of turbine auxiliary oil pumps, specifically seal oil pumps, seal oil vacuum pumps, stator coolant pumps, and ammonia dosing pumps. This project spans a duration of five years, emphasizing the need for reliable and efficient pump operations to support the power generation process. Bidders must provide a comprehensive plan that includes refurbishment methodologies, timelines, and quality assurance measures.
Key requirements include adherence to safety regulations, environmental compliance, and the ability to meet specified performance standards. Contractors will be expected to submit detailed proposals that outline their experience in similar projects, technical capabilities, and resources available for the successful execution of the refurbishment tasks. The successful bidder will contribute to the operational efficiency and reliability of the power station, ensuring that critical auxiliary systems function optimally to support energy production.
This tender is suitable for businesses specializing in mechanical engineering, pump refurbishment, and maintenance services within the energy sector. Companies with experience in high-risk environments and a proven track record in adhering to safety and environmental standards are encouraged to apply.
